  16. #ifndef MBED_ANALOGIN_H
  17. #define MBED_ANALOGIN_H
  18. #include "platform.h"
  19. #if DEVICE_ANALOGIN
  20. #include "analogin_api.h"
  21. namespace mbed {
  22. /** An analog input, used for reading the voltage on a pin
  23. *
  24. * Example:
  25. * @code
  26. * // Print messages when the AnalogIn is greater than 50%
  27. *
  28. * #include "mbed.h"
  29. *
  30. * AnalogIn temperature(p20);
  31. *
  32. * int main() {
  33. * while(1) {
  34. * if(temperature > 0.5) {
  35. * printf("Too hot! (%f)", temperature.read());
  36. * }
  37. * }
  38. * }
  39. * @endcode
  40. */
  41. class AnalogIn {
  42. public:
  43. /** Create an AnalogIn, connected to the specified pin
  44. *
  45. * @param pin AnalogIn pin to connect to
  46. * @param name (optional) A string to identify the object
  47. */
  48. AnalogIn(PinName pin) {
  49. analogin_init(&_adc, pin);
  50. }
  51. /** Read the input voltage, represented as a float in the range [0.0, 1.0]
  52. *
  53. * @returns A floating-point value representing the current input voltage, measured as a percentage
  54. */
  55. float read() {
  56. return analogin_read(&_adc);
  57. }
  58. /** Read the input voltage, represented as an unsigned short in the range [0x0, 0xFFFF]
  59. *
  60. * @returns
  61. * 16-bit unsigned short representing the current input voltage, normalised to a 16-bit value
  62. */
  63. unsigned short read_u16() {
  64. return analogin_read_u16(&_adc);
  65. }
  66. #ifdef MBED_OPERATORS
  67. /** An operator shorthand for read()
  68. *
  69. * The float() operator can be used as a shorthand for read() to simplify common code sequences
  70. *
  71. * Example:
  72. * @code
  73. * float x = volume.read();
  74. * float x = volume;
  75. *
  76. * if(volume.read() > 0.25) { ... }
  77. * if(volume > 0.25) { ... }
  78. * @endcode
  79. */
  80. operator float() {
  81. return read();
  82. }
  83. #endif
  84. protected:
  85. analogin_t _adc;
  86. };
  87. } // namespace mbed
  88. #endif
  89. #endif
